Which group thought the colonists were adequately represented in Parliament? a. Patriots b. Tories c. Whigs d. Workers

Answer :

katiebugogden
katiebugogden katiebugogden
  • 12-01-2015
The Tories were the group that thought the colonists were adequately represented in Parliament, Tories are basically loyalist.
